WOW!  That is some great lifting by such a young man.  I hope he continues to make progress, stays healthy and can bring some more exposure to this great sport!

According to my calculations which are to be taken with a grain of salt, he should be capable of a 280kg back squat.  That means he has the strength for a 389 total with a 173 snatch and a 216 clean and jerk.  Of course, everyone is different I my experience is to throw the calculators out with the super heavys anyway.  The results of the Arnolds list him at 128kgs BW and a 160/195/355 total.  He attempted 166/205 for misses on his last attempts.  Incredible lifting for a "novice" with room to grow!
